According to the ancient Vedic thought, there are seven circles (Chakras) of energy referred to as energy wheels in the human body. These are present along the meridian of the body.
It is generally accepted that there are seven of these chakra energy-wheels, although some practitioners maintain that there are in fact 14.
These begin at the base of the spine/genitals (root chakra) and extend right up to the top of the head (crown chakra).
In between are the orange colored chakra situated in the stomach area, the yellow colored chakra known as the solar plexus just above this, the green colored chakra in the heart region, the blue colored throat chakra, the indigo colored chakra in the center of the forehead known as the third eye. The root chakra is colored red with the crown chakra thought of as being violet in color.
The numbering of these chakras 1 to 7 begins at the base of the spine, which is chakra number one. This numbering coincides with the spectrum along the wavelength of light.
The first of these chakras is responsible for our vitality, sexual and physical health.
The second chakra commands our creative powers.
The third chakra is responsible for our desires and what we want.
Chakra four at the heart commands our emotional energy that opens us up to giving and receiving love.
The fifth chakra is responsible for communicating and is the link between what we feel and what we think.
The sixth chakra commands intuition and psychic powers and insights, (hence the sixth sense).
The seventh chakra is used to take us on astral voyages and connects us with cosmic awareness, some of which is what is captured and brought back down to the second chakra during artistic practices and which is also accessed on shamanic journeys.

The principle behind these chakras or wheels is that in a clean and healthy mind, these wheels will spin freely. And a spinning wheel will emit the most positive and strongest good energies for the person. However, if these wheels cannot spin due to some blockage, the person will experience sickness problems, both mentally and physically amid his or her chakras.
No chakra should be more developed than the others, either. If this happens then addictions, neuroses, obsessive-compulsive disorders, or unintentional cruelty will result.
Chakras can become unbalanced or clogged as a result of neglect or bad lifestyle. If your diet is bad, or you have a negative attitude toward sexual relations you will have problems with your first or root/base chakra. This is likely to lead to ill health and broken or difficult relationships.
The seventh chakra is prone to disruption in people who are forever thinking of negative actions towards others like working black magic. When this purple-white wheel is disturbed, the cosmic connection is hampered. Consequently the person feels bitter, fearful, and empty.
A freely spinning energy wheel will be characteristically flexible. The human mind has the power to receive good vibes and ward off bad and negative ones. It is just like a hand, which can open and close when required but if broken, it will not function. Similarly a healthy chakra will open and close as per the vibes it encounters.
Chakra therapy means basically that you focus your attention and concentration on each of the seven main chakras in turn. This should really be done on a daily basis.
Look at each chakra area by meditating and seeing how its aspects are manifesting in your life. You do this by visualizing your body’s energy in that particular chakra. If you become aware that your chakra energy is lacking in any particular category, then you can use meditation to make that particular chakra healthy and balanced.
Some people find that meditating on a gem stone the same color as the chakra wheel allows them to get a clear image in their mind of what actions they need to take to make it healthier.
